Coopertown Police Welcomes Two New Officers

Coopertown, Tennessee
September 1, 2021

On Wednesday, September 1, 2021, Coopertown Police swore in two new officers. The department would like to welcome Officer Austin Zumbroegel and Officer Matthew Day to the family. Both Officers are Ohio natives and bring a wealth of experience and skill to the team. Officer Day is a veteran of the U. S. Army and has many years of law enforcement experience. Officer Zumbroegel is a former firefighter and armed guard.

Both officers will be going through a comprehensive field training program and will attend the Tennessee Law Enforcement Training Academy (TLETA). Please help us welcome Officer Day and Officer Zumbroegel to Coopertown. Feel free to say hello to them if you see them in the community.
